RS232C interface specifications
Hardware |
EComplies with EIA-232-D D-SUB 9-pin connector (male)*1 Baud rate: 1200, 2400, 4800, 9600, or 19200 bps Data length: 8 bits, stop bit: 1 bit, and parity bit: None Flow control: Xon/Xoff |
Program message terminator |
LF during reception, CR+LF during transmission |
*1. Use a cross cable (null modem cable).
GPIB interface specifications (IB21 option)
Hardware |
Complies with IEEE Std 488.1-1978 SH1, AH1, T6, L4, SR1, RL1, PP0, DC1, DT1, C0, E1 |
Program message terminator |
LF or EOI during reception, LF+EOI during transmission |
Primary address |
1 to 30 |
USB interface specifications (US21 option)
Hardware |
Complies with USB 2.0. Data rate: 12 Mbps (full speed). |
Program message terminator |
LF or EOM during reception, LF+EOM during transmission |
Device class |
Complies with the USBTMC-USB488 device class specifications |
